Custom Glass Tumblers: How Traditional Branded Glassware Creates Elegant Brand Presence in Hospitality and Corporate Settings
Custom glass tumblers are transparent promotional drinkware items constructed from tempered soda-lime or borosilicate glass that feature etched, sandblasted, or screen-fired company logos, monograms, or decorative patterns applied through permanent marking techniques. The customization permanence achieved through glass etching and sandblasting techniques creates marketing longevity that withstands thousands of commercial dishwasher cycles without logo degradation or visual deterioration. Restaurant operators report that properly etched branded glassware maintains 95% of original marking clarity after five years of daily commercial use, justifying initial customization investment through extended brand exposure periods. This durability factor proves particularly valuable for establishments where glassware replacement occurs gradually over time rather than through complete inventory refreshes, enabling consistent brand presence throughout multi-year operational periods.

The temperature conductivity of glass provides immediate tactile feedback about beverage temperature that influences drinking pace and consumption patterns differently than insulated alternatives. While stainless steel vacuum insulation maintains beverage temperature for hours, glass conducts heat and cold directly to the exterior surface, enabling users to gauge beverage temperature through touch before drinking. This characteristic proves particularly valuable for beverage service environments where temperature assessment influences consumption timing, with bartenders and servers using glass surface temperature as service readiness indicators for temperature-sensitive drinks.
